Engineering Downloads

Let’s Learn and Collaborate

Engineering Downloads

Mixing Milk and Honey: Simulating Miscible Fluid Dynamics with interMixingFoam in OpenFoam

40,00 60,00
40,00 60,00
21 people watching this product now!

Material Includes

  • A clear and concise guide to mastering OpenFOAM simulations.

Audience

  • Mechanical Engineers
  • Engineering Students

What You Will Learn?

  • How to use the interMixingFoam solver for miscible three-phase flow (milk, honey, air)
  • How to build a custom cup geometry with two inlets using blockMeshDict and parametric C++ macros
  • How to control time-based inlet behavior using groovyBC (e.g., milk enters 2 seconds after honey)
  • How to simulate initial fluid regions using setFields
  • Accurate definition of transport properties, including Newtonian viscosity, surface tension, and diffusivity
  • How to run parallel simulations using decomposePar and mpirun
  • How to visualize volume fractions, velocity, and pressure fields in ParaView
  • Comparing mesh resolutions (e.g., 20, 30, 40) and their impact on simulation accuracy

About Course

Product Overview:

In this hands-on CFD tutorial, we simulate a real-world everyday scenario with strong engineering relevance: the mixing of milk and honey in a cup. Using OpenFOAM’s interMixingFoam solver, we investigate how fluids of very different viscosities interact in a multiphase, gravity-influenced system with air as the third component.

This tutorial emphasizes advanced OpenFOAM concepts including miscible multiphase flow, boundary control with groovyBC, setFields initialization, and accurate interface capture. It’s the perfect follow-up to the “Water Pushes Out Crude Oil” simulation.

Course Content

Simulation Files

  • Tutorial Video
    37:31
  • Modeling Files

Reviews

No Review Yet
No Review Yet
40,00 60,00
21 people watching this product now!

Material Includes

  • A clear and concise guide to mastering OpenFOAM simulations.

Audience

  • Mechanical Engineers
  • Engineering Students

Related  Products

See more

Want to receive push notifications for all major on-site activities?